Transaction e63d33db591d160a43c35109a033a8e34f8aaec73a1b0b9334e269b8ef711271

1 Input
2 Outputs
  • e63d33db591d160a43c35109a033a8e34f8aaec73a1b0b9334e269b8ef711271:0
  • value  308124
    address  13JZSoio1Yk2GQK5sYEtNTY5RgrxAG8Smb
  • e63d33db591d160a43c35109a033a8e34f8aaec73a1b0b9334e269b8ef711271:1
  • value  5049676
    address  3HtzbRBr4hH3rCrF8rAg3R6PAhRvCYkknS